Daphne Higginbotham Battles the Fifth Grade is a tender, uplifting story about the power of formative friendships. Daphne is an international adoptee from China living with her family in small-town Georgia. She just wants to survive the fifth grade but her best friend has autism, she's being targeted by a bully named Agnes and her teacher may be a zombie! This is a humorous tale of an imaginative, outspoken, misfit. No matter what happens Daphne won't give up and along the way she'll learn to see familiar people in new ways. Daphne and her friends can overcome anything together!

Autorenporträt
Rosemary Starr is an elementary school teacher and mother of three children. She has been the director of a girl's home in Thailand, a foster care provider and an adoptive parent and she cares deeply about the lives of children. Rosemary lives in the Texas hill country with her family and dogs.
